Synopsis
A mail client installed on the remote macOS or Mac OS X host is affected by multiple vulnerabilities.
Description
The version of Thunderbird installed on the remote macOS or Mac OS X host is prior to 68.2. It is, therefore, affected by multiple vulnerabilities as referenced in the mfsa2019-35 advisory.
- In libexpat before 2.2.8, crafted XML input could fool the parser into changing from DTD parsing to document parsing too early; a consecutive call to XML_GetCurrentLineNumber (or XML_GetCurrentColumnNumber) then resulted in a heap-based buffer over-read.
(CVE-2019-15903)
Note that Nessus has not tested for this issue but has instead relied only on the application's self-reported version number.
Solution
Upgrade to Mozilla Thunderbird version 68.2 or later.
